Utilizing dent pulling tools In general this repair process is rather basic. Essentially, a specialist or person will use a PDR glue and a dent pulling tool to get rid of the dent. The individual usually positions the glue on the front-side of the car body panels and then utilizes a dent puller to take out one side of that glue in order to develop stress (paintless dent removal cost).
This procedure is duplicated till there are no more noticeable repair work. A reflector board is utilized to ensure that the panel is flat. If you are attempting to remove a dent yourself, it's finest to try to use paintless dent repair tools with minimal pressure when possible. It can be tempting to try and pry out large damages rapidly, however this might cause more damage than good in many cases.
When the dent is located on a vehicle body panel, it can be pushed outwards by this tool. With the assistance of a reflector board, you can find a dent and push up on the metal with minimal force.
Another important factor of utilizing rods is that you won't need to do any sort of paint finish or paint work at all. That is why a collision dent service center will utilize this technique as their go-to when it comes to removing hail damage dents. It minimizes the repair time and the total repair expense.
Can dents be completely eliminated with paintless dent repair? A vehicle dent can be totally eliminated with paintless dent repair. The outcomes will look like the automobile has never been damaged or perhaps took out of a dealer store! It works best on small and mid-sized dings that lie on the vehicle's body panels (car hood dent repair cost).
Can you do PDR yourself with paintless dent removal tools? There are lots of paintless dent repair kits that allow you to do the task yourself. You can get some of these low-cost sets for under $50, or you could purchase a complete PDR set for around $100 dollars. The paint of your automobile will not suffer any damage, as you are just using tools to push the metal back into place.
